Impact of small scale inhomogeneities on observations of standard candles
We investigate the effect of small scale inhomogeneities on standard candle
observations, such as type Ia supernovae (SNe) observations. Existence of the
small scale inhomogeneities may cause a tension between SNe observations and
other observations with larger diameter sources, such as the cosmic microwave
background (CMB) observation. To clarify the impact of the small scale
inhomogeneities, we use the Dyer-Roeder approach. We determined the smoothness
parameter as a function of the redshift so as to compensate the
deviation of cosmological parameters for SNe from those for CMB. The range of
the deviation which can be compensated by the smoothness parameter
satisfying is reported. Our result suggests that the
tension may give us the information of the small scale inhomogeneities through
